TDG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

765 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in TransDigm Group (TDG)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$44.8B — down 6.2% from $47.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 77 funds opened new TDG positions and 49 closed out — a net gain of 28 holders — while 272 added to existing stakes and 271 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$672M. The largest seller was Abrams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$280M sold.
